A study of the work experience commitments and academic achievements of high school students

Abstract
This research outlines a study of the relationship between the part-time work experience commitments and academic achievements of high school students in Alberta's Parkland School Division. Significant research conducted over the past two decades disagrees whether part-time work has adverse effects on student achievement. Economic conditions in Canada have tempted high school students to be employed in various labor roles based on a number of factors. Specifically, this study examines the relationship between the work experience hours and academic achievements of Parkland School Division's secondary school students. The author hypothesizes that when hours of work increase, student achievement decreases. An analysis of the 2009-2010 high school data of work experience hours submitted for high school credits toward attaining a diploma will be compared to student achievement in the School Division's high school, Spruce Grove Composite High. A quantitative investigation by means of a multi-variable regression analysis for each grade level, namely Grade 12, Grade 11, and Grade 10, exhibited no significant correlations among the dependent variables (English, Social Studies, and Mathematics marks) and the independent variable, Work Experience Hours. The results of the research analysis did not support the author's hypotheses that this relationship would be significantly negative and that it would increase in relation to the number of hours worked. The information acquired will be reported to assist Parkland School Division and other school jurisdictions to improve educational programming for secondary students. --Leaf ii.
